How to Choose the Right Labeling Machine
Round needs wrap-around; tall/thin items <φ15mm require horizontal conveying (HL-T-402).
Mismatching filling speed with labeling capacity creates expensive downtime or overflows.
Determine if you need static labels or real-time variable data (Print & Apply).
Choose standalone for batches or inline integrated for smart factory synchronization.

Questions & Technical Answers
How do you prevent vials from falling over during high-speed labeling?
Horizontal systems (e.g., HL-T-402) use a roller structure and star-wheel rotation to mechanically stabilize containers that are unstable vertically. This eliminates tipping risks.
Can I achieve bubble-free labeling on flat surfaces?
Yes — bubble-free labeling is achievable.
Our synchronized pressing system ensures even pressure during application, eliminating air pockets even on flat surfaces.
What is the benefit of a Print & Apply system?
Unlike static labels, the HL-T-806 prints variable data (QR codes, shipping info) in real-time, allowing for unique product traceability and ERP integration per individual unit.
